package scm
import (
"context"
"errors"
"fmt"
"os"
"strconv"
"strings"
"time"
"github.com/gabrie30/ghorg/colorlog"
"github.com/google/go-github/v72/github"
)
const (
// maxGithubRepoListConcurrency caps GHORG_GITHUB_REPO_LIST_CONCURRENCY when set (typo guard).
maxGithubRepoListConcurrency = 1024
maxGithubRepoListRetries = 6
// githubRateLimitLogMinWait: detailed rate-limit logs only if backoff exceeds this.
githubRateLimitLogMinWait = 30 * time.Second
)
// githubListWorkerCount returns how many concurrent workers to use for
// paginated GitHub repo listing (pages beyond the first). If
// GHORG_GITHUB_REPO_LIST_CONCURRENCY is unset or empty, all extra pages are
// listed in parallel (historical ghorg behavior). If set to a positive
// integer, at most that many list requests run at once.
func githubListWorkerCount(extraPages int) int {
if extraPages < 1 {
return 1
}
s := strings.TrimSpace(os.Getenv("GHORG_GITHUB_REPO_LIST_CONCURRENCY"))
if s == "" {
return extraPages
}
n, err := strconv.Atoi(s)
if err != nil || n < 1 {
return extraPages
}
if n > maxGithubRepoListConcurrency {
n = maxGithubRepoListConcurrency
}
if n > extraPages {
return extraPages
}
return n
}

func sleepForGitHubRateLimit(ctx context.Context, attempt int, err error) error {
var wait time.Duration
var abuse *github.AbuseRateLimitError
var primary *github.RateLimitError
switch {
case errors.As(err, &abuse):
if abuse.RetryAfter != nil && *abuse.RetryAfter > 0 {
wait = *abuse.RetryAfter
} else {
wait = time.Duration(30*(attempt+1)) * time.Second
}
case errors.As(err, &primary):
wait = time.Until(primary.Rate.Reset.Time) + 2*time.Second
if wait < time.Second {
wait = time.Second
}
}
if wait <= 0 {
wait = time.Second
}
const maxWait = 5 * time.Minute
waitCapped := false
if wait > maxWait {
wait = maxWait
waitCapped = true
}
if wait > githubRateLimitLogMinWait {
logGithubRateLimitWait(attempt, err, wait, waitCapped)
}
t := time.NewTimer(wait)
defer t.Stop()
select {
case <-ctx.Done():
return ctx.Err()
case <-t.C:
return nil
}
}
// fetchGitHubRepoPageWithRetry calls fetch until success or a nonrate-limit
// error, or retries are exhausted.
func fetchGitHubRepoPageWithRetry(ctx context.Context, fetch func(context.Context) ([]*github.Repository, error)) ([]*github.Repository, error) {
for attempt := 0; attempt < maxGithubRepoListRetries; attempt++ {
repos, err := fetch(ctx)
if err == nil {
return repos, nil
}
if !isGitHubListRateLimitError(err) || attempt == maxGithubRepoListRetries-1 {
return nil, err
}
if err := sleepForGitHubRateLimit(ctx, attempt, err); err != nil {
return nil, err
}
}
panic("unreachable: github list retries")
}
